Harriett split from Love Island boyfriend Ronnie Vint in Septmber and just weeks later revealed she was already on the hunt for a new man.

If she does join Towie, Harriett won’t be the first former Love Islander to do so.

Series two winners Cara De La Hoyde and Nathan Massey previously appeared on the show alongside pals Georgia Kousoulou and Tommy Mallet.

Olivia Attwood, who starred in the third series, joined Towie in 2019 and appeared in 16 episodes.

And most recently Sammy Root – who won Love Island last year with ex-girlfriend Jess Harding – became a Towie cast member during the latest series.

It comes after former show star Bobby Norris insisted Towie should be axed as he spoke about the current viewing figures.

Speaking to his Access All Areas co-host Ellen Coughlan on Fubar Radio, he said: “I was a little bit sad, because in my day we used to get between 1.5 million and 2 million views an episode.

“So when I saw 48,000 viewers, even though I’m not there, it’s sad. I think the legacy is kind of going so downhill now.

“Since the day I left, I’ve never watched the show, but if you can’t even pull in 50,000 viewers, I think, do you know what? Give the show the respect it deserves.

“It’s like having a dog in the corner of the kitchen that’s dragging a broken leg, like you would be kind, and you’d take him to the vet and let him go to sleep.”
